Painted the 1974 KG Coupe. I thought it came out pretty good. I'll admit I may have lower standards than some since this was my first paint job…and I want to get her on the road. However the hood does not even meet my low standards. I think I have a couple problems. There are streaks - so I think I didn’t lay the paint down very well.

My plan is to sand and respray base and clear. My most important question is to what grit should I sand before respraying the base and clear? Surely I don’t need to go all the way through the base coat… But should I do more then scuff? It’s been about 6 weeks since I painted her.

Complicating things, there are obvious flaws that go deeper than the paint.

I can feel the flaws... I have no idea how I missed them prior to painting...

So my plan is to resand and fill these bad areas as necessary. But again to what grit? Does this change things since I will be using filler? And do I need to spray a primer / sealer before base coat / clear coat?
